Manage Your Santa Clarita Properties With A Real Estate Virtual Assistant

As a Santa Clarita real estate agent you know the market can be hot, and the job can be an exciting one. But you probably also know that sometimes it can be stressful, too. Most of that stress comes from having a lot to handle in a short period of time. It’s easy to feel overwhelmed if you have a lot of deals going on at once. If you work with a real estate virtual assistant, though, you can delegate a lot of duties to them. The same is true with a property management virtual assistant if you’re dealing with rentals.

What Can a Real Estate Virtual Assistant Offer?

A real estate virtual assistant is unique, in that they can provide help and support that’s unique to the needs of the real estate industry. Hiring an assistant who isn’t used to this field is rarely a good choice. It’s too much of a learning curve, and there are some very specific issues that need to be addressed when a property is changing hands. Whether you typically work with sellers as the listing agent, buyers as their personal agent, or in dual agency situations, delegating tasks to a knowledgeable assistant can help.

Some agents worry about the virtual nature of this kind of support, but that’s not a problem. So many areas of a real estate transaction can be handled online today, that a real estate virtual assistant can do nearly everything an in-office assistant would be able to do, as well. It can be beneficial to work with a virtual assistant who is in your same geographic location, mostly so they’re familiar with any specific rules and regulations. However, that’s not a requirement. Assistants from other areas can also be extremely valuable.

The most important aspect of working with a real estate virtual assistant is the delegation of paperwork, advertising, listings, closing documents, and other details. When you have those things taken care of by someone else, you can more easily spend your time on other aspects of your business. These include bringing in more listings, working closely with buyers, and interacting with others in your community to get your name and abilities out to people who may be looking to buy or sell properties in the future.

Do You Need a Property Management Virtual Assistant?

A property management virtual assistant can also help real estate agents with duties surrounding rentals. From providing the rental agreement to handling maintenance requests and more, these assistants make it easier and less complicated for agents to manage their schedules and properties. Especially for agents who have a lot of rentals, or for those who want to actively recruit more landlords, a property management virtual assistant can be a very beneficial member of the team.

Very few aspects of property management actually need to be handled in person, so using a virtual assistant can make it easy for agents, property owners, and tenants. That helps keep properties rented, which is beneficial to everyone involved. For agents, property management can be a great addition to working with buyers and sellers. Naturally, property owners also want to keep their units rented for the income that provides. Tenants also benefit, because they can find a great place and get moved in more easily.
